

Camunda and BiZZdesign HoriZZon are key players in business process management and enterprise architecture. Camunda has the upper hand due to its active community and ease of building workflows.
Features: Camunda offers lightweight architecture, scalability, and BPMN compliance, making it highly adaptable with robust REST API and open-source accessibility. It allows for easy workflow creation with reusable components. BiZZdesign HoriZZon is strong in enterprise architecture management with flexibility in modeling standards like ArchiMate and strategic planning tools.
Room for Improvement: Camunda could improve its proprietary UI and form creation tools, provide clearer documentation, and enhance support for additional programming languages. BiZZdesign HoriZZon could benefit from better integration capabilities, improved usability of its REST APIs, and more competitive pricing, along with a more intuitive user interface and enhanced technical support.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Camunda supports flexible deployment for both on-premises and cloud environments with open-source community engagement but faces challenges in technical support. In contrast, BiZZdesign HoriZZon is cloud-based and offers dedicated enterprise-level support, known for being responsive and efficient.
Pricing and ROI: Camunda is considered cost-effective, especially for startups using its open-source model, but substantial growth may lead to increased costs due to a per-process pricing model. Users find BiZZdesign HoriZZon expensive, although both products deliver positive ROI by effectively supporting complex processes and modeling.

BiZZdesign HoriZZon offers robust enterprise architecture modeling, seamless collaboration, and supports ArchiMate standards, benefiting organizations with efficient integration capabilities, intuitive features, and stakeholder accessibility.
BiZZdesign HoriZZon facilitates enterprise architecture through its strong modeling features in Enterprise Studio, providing collaborative dashboards and integration with systems like ServiceNow and SQL databases. Known for quick loading times and diagrammatic representation, it supports multiple modeling languages while maintaining an intuitive web interface. Despite its strengths, organizations find challenges with interface complexity, high costs, a steep learning curve, and scalability in large datasets.
What are the key features of BiZZdesign HoriZZon?BiZZdesign HoriZZon serves industries focused on enterprise architecture, aiding in project governance and application portfolio management. Organizations in sectors like finance, manufacturing, and IT leverage it to align architectural elements with business goals, centralize architecture data, and optimize processes for better decision-making and oversight.
Camunda offers a process orchestration platform that automates and streamlines AI processes while integrating human tasks and diverse systems without sacrificing security, governance, or innovation.
Camunda empowers businesses and IT to collaborate effectively, addressing complexity, enhancing efficiency, and maintaining competitiveness at any speed or scale. Trusted by over 700 organizations including Atlassian, ING, and Vodafone, it designs, orchestrates, automates, and improves critical business processes to accelerate digital transformation. It is flexible and lightweight, easily integrating with APIs and microservices, while adhering to BPMN, CMMN, and DMN standards for comprehensive process modeling and automation.
What are Camunda's standout features?Organizations use Camunda to automate business processes across industries like banking, logistics, telecommunications, and retail. It supports complex workflows such as loan approvals and integrates third-party applications. Known for managing tasks and process automation, it fits seamlessly with existing systems on-premise or in cloud environments like Azure and AWS.
